At their core, cattle load bars are specialized scales used to measure the weight of cattle accurately. These bars are typically made up of a series of load cells, which are sensors that convert the weight of the animal into an electrical signal. This signal is then translated into a readable weight measurement, allowing farm operators to efficiently assess their livestock without unnecessary stress for the animals.
Cattle load bars are usually placed on the ground or integrated into existing handling systems, such as chutes or livestock scales. This not only simplifies the weighing process but also minimizes the time cattle spend off their feed and in the weighing area, which ultimately improves animal welfare. Many models can handle substantial weight capacities and are built to withstand the rugged conditions often found in farming environments.
One of the latest advancements in cattle load bar technology is the integration of digital displays that provide real-time weight measurements. These displays can be connected to smartphones or tablets, allowing farmers to track the weight of their cattle remotely. Additionally, many modern cattle load bars come equipped with software that logs weight data over time, providing valuable insights into growth trends and overall herd health.
In terms of operational efficiency, utilizing cattle load bars can lead to significant time savings. Traditional weighing methods can be labor-intensive, involving manual handling and multiple steps to get an accurate reading. With load bars, this process can be streamlined; operators can quickly and efficiently weigh animals without excessive handling. This not only reduces labor hours but also lessens the stress on livestock, which is crucial for maintaining their health and productivity.

Moreover, cattle load bars are often designed for portability, allowing farmers to use them in various locations around their farms. This flexibility means that cattle can be weighed where they are most accustomed to being handled, further reducing stress and improving the accuracy of the measurements.
Another important aspect of cattle load bars is their role in decision-making. Accurate weight measurements are crucial for various farming practices, including feed management, breeding decisions, and health assessments. By regularly weighing cattle, farmers can ensure that animals are growing as expected and make timely changes to their feeding regimens or health interventions if needed.
In recent years, sustainability and traceability have become increasingly important in livestock production. Cattle load bars facilitate better record-keeping and analysis, enabling producers to demonstrate compliance with sustainability practices and support claims about animal welfare. By having accurate, accessible data on cattle weights and growth rates, farmers can provide transparency to consumers about their production methods.
